Well... the chrysalis is some type of Papilionid - they do the suspended hanging thing.

That is a skipper, possibly a Hoary Edge, Achalarus lyciades.I don't think that's a plant hopper - you can already see the prominent scutellum, so it'd be a true bug in the old order Hemiptera. Based on the body shape, I'd guess Miridae or Lygaeidae, but those are hardly reliable ID's.
